  Job Summary

  This role supervises capital pipeline projects and restoration of gas distribution facilities, project and resource management, customer involvement and monitoring of work. Supports reliability performance goals. Supervises crews during outages to ensure timely restoration of service. Schedules, assigns and monitors the work of construction crews and / or contractors. Pre / post inspect jobs, resolves design problems and material discrepancies, reviews contractor expenses to ensure accurate time and equipment charges. Ensures proper work methods are applied and safety precautions are followed. Resolves customer complaints. Advises and assists in technical training and development of employees. Supervises emergency restoration of service activities, including night management of packaging work. Utilization of GIS, SAP, Microsoft excel and word applications. Monitors budget goals and employee productivity. Oversees operations and procedures of direct reports to ensure productivity, as well as, compliance with company, state and federal rules, regulations and policies: responsible for company assets and budgets. Continually look for ways to improve process and procedures, not only within the department, but throughout all Design and Construction at Springside. Interpret policies, procedures, agreements and terms and conditions. Develop bargaining unit employees by providing training, mentoring, development and oversite of activities for assigned employees including completion of performance reviews.

  Required Knowledge, Skills, Abilities & Experience

  7+ years directly related experience (plus Associate's degree or its equivalency in years of experience) or at least 5 years of directly related experience (plus Bachelor's degree)

  Proficient in MS Word and Excel

  Full knowledge of pipeline distribution system; construction work methods; maintenance and repair; operations guidelines; cost analysis; customer service; essential computer skills.

  Skills: leadership; contract interpretation; interpersonal; strong verbal and written communication; project and time management; planning and organizing; decision making; teaming; training; manage multiple priorities and construction projects simultaneously; flexibility.

  Abilities: teaming; motivate employees; decision making; handle constantly changing and emerging priorities; schedule and prioritize work; physical attributes required to perform essential function of the job - walking, climbing, stooping, bending and prolonged standing.

  Our Commitment to NetZero by 2050

  We’ve cut carbon emissions from our electric generation business by approximately 46% (since 2005) and methane emissions from our natural gas business by 38% (since 2010) — By growing wind, solar, and renewable natural gas and pursuing innovative technologies, we expect to achieve net zero emissions by 2050. We’ve also committed to reducing the emissions of our suppliers and customers — so we can all move forward together.
